How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Works
A proper Bathroom Water Damage Restoration process needs a systematic approach. Our team follows a step-by-step protocol to ensure that every aspect of the job is handled with care and precision. From initial assessment to final inspection, we’ll guide you through the process every step of the way.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We’ll assess the extent of the damage and contain the area to prevent further water intrusion. This step is crucial in preventing more damage and ensuring a safe working environment for our technicians.
Step 2: Water Removal
We’ll use specialized equipment to remove standing water from your home, including flooded floors, walls, and ceilings. Our team will carefully extract the water, using pumps and vacuums to reduce the risk of further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air, and high-velocity fans to speed up the drying process. Our team will monitor moisture levels and adjust the drying process as needed to ensure that your home is completely dry and safe.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ize all surfaces, including walls, floors, and ceilings, to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. Our team will use eco-friendly cleaning products that are safe for your family and pets.
Step 5: Reconstruction and Repair
Once the drying process is complete, our team will begin the reconstruction and repair process. We’ll replace damaged drywall, flooring, and ceilings, and restore your home to its original condition.

Warning Signs You Need Bathroom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ards. Our team is here to help you identify the signs that show you need Bathroom Water Damage Restoration in Hamlin, NY.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old and mildew. These bacteria thrive in damp environments and can cause serious health issues. If you notice persistent musty smells in your bathroom, it’s time to call our team.
Water Stains and Discoloration
Water stains and discoloration on your walls, ceilings, and floors can show water intrusion. These stains can be a sign of a larger issue, such as a leaky pipe or a clogged drain. Don’t ignore these signs, our team is here to help.
Flooding and Standing Water
Flooding and standing water in your bathroom can be a sign of a serious issue. Our team will assess the situation and provide a plan to safely remove the water and restore your home.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age. Our team will assess the extent of the damage and provide a plan to restore your flooring to its original condition.
Peeling Paint and Wallpaper
Peeling paint and w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. Our team will assess the situation and provide a plan to restore your walls to their original condition.

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Cost in Hamlin, NY
The cost of Bathroom Water Damage Restoration in Hamlin, NY,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are realistic and based on the actual costs of materials and labor.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local labor costs |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of equipment used |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Type of cleaning products used, size of affected area, and severity of damage |
| Reconstruction and rep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of materials used |
Keep in mind that ex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ates to all our customers.

Common Questions About Bathroom Water Damage Restoration
Q: What causes bathroom water damage?
A: Bathroom water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including leaks, clogged drains, and faulty appliances. Our team can help you identify the underlying issue and provide a plan to prevent future occurrences.
Q: How long does the bathroom water damage restoration process take?
A: The length of the restoration process varies dep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will provide a detailed timeline and schedule for the project.
Q: Is bathroom water damage restoration covered by insurance?
A: In most cases, yes. Our team will work with your insurance provider to ensure that you receive the coverage you’re entitled to. We’ll handle the claims process and advocate on your behalf.
Q: Can bathroom water damage lead to health issues?
A: Yes. Water damage can create an environment conducive to mold and mildew growth, which can lead to serious health issues. Our team will take all necessary precautions to ensure a safe working environment and provide guidance on how to prevent future occurrences.
Q: What can I do to prevent bathroom water damage in the future?
A: Regular maintenance is key. Check your appliances and plumbing regularly, and address any issues quickly. Our team can provide guidance on how to prevent future occurrences and recommend preventative measures.
